Isaac Babadi Transfer from PSV to Feyenoord
Isaac Babadi, a promising midfielder at PSV, is facing uncertainty regarding his future with the club due to limited playing opportunities. Despite his impressive performances against Arsenal and RKC, Babadi often finds himself playing for Jong PSV under coach Alfons Groenendijk, which underscores his struggle to secure consistent first-team action. Robin van Persie, who is now the head coach of Feyenoord, had previously expressed interest in signing Babadi for Heerenveen, but the transfer did not come to fruition. With van Persie's move to Feyenoord, there is a new aspect to consider in Babadi's potential transfer, as it remains unclear whether the Rotterdam club will pursue him again after the season. Last year, Feyenoord was in the race to secure Babadi's signature on a long-term contract, but he chose to remain with PSV. As Babadi looks for more playing time, a discussion with PSV's club leadership is expected at the end of the season, with possibilities of a loan or even a sale being considered if his situation does not improve.
